Risk Prediction Using PROPKD Score

Cornec-Le Gall et al developed the PROPKD score as a prognostic model to predict renal outcomes in patients with ADPKD on the basis of genetic and clinical data from 1341 patients from the Genkyst cohort.50 The scoring system assigns points as shown in Table 5. Thus, an individual’s PROPKD score can range from 0 to 9 points. Three risk categories of progression to ESRD were subsequently defined: low (0-3 points), intermediate (4-6 points), and high (7-9 points). The predicted median age of onset for ESRD and predicted disease progression for these 3 risk categories are listed in Table 6. Of note, the PROPKD scoring system cannot be applied to patients with no history of urological events or hypertension and has not been widely validated in independent cohorts.

Table 5. The PROPKD Scoring System.

Factor Points
Male 1
Hypertension before age 35 years 2
First urological event before age 35 years 2
PKD2 mutation 0
Nontruncating PKD1 mutation 2
Truncating PKD1 mutation 4

Table 6. Predicted Median Age of Onset of ESRD and Predicted Disease Progression by PROPKD Risk Category.

  PROPKD risk category for progression to ESRD
  Low risk (0-3 points) Intermediate risk (4-6 points) High risk (7-9 points)
Predicted median age of onset for ESRD,y 70.6 56.9 49.0
Predicted disease progression Excludes progression to ESRD before 60 years of age (negative predictive value of 81.4%) Prognosis is unclear Rapid progression to ESRD before 60 years of age (positive predictive value of 90.9%)
